Sha256: e642d8a7d28068c34cd18dc28a7a0e6d454a8ac3d06174907e6dbb11550d9333

Contents?: true

Size: 601 Bytes

Versions: 427

Compression:

Stored size: 601 Bytes

Contents

module Screengrab
  class Setup
    # This method will take care of creating a screengrabfile and other necessary files
    def self.create(path)
      screengrabfile_path = File.join(path, 'Screengrabfile')

      if File.exist?(screengrabfile_path)
        UI.user_error!("Screengrabfile already exists at path '#{screengrabfile_path}'. Run 'screengrab' to use screengrab.")
      end

      File.write(screengrabfile_path, File.read("#{Screengrab::ROOT}/lib/assets/ScreengrabfileTemplate"))

      UI.success("Successfully created new Screengrabfile at '#{screengrabfile_path}'")
    end
  end
end

Version data entries

427 entries across 427 versions & 2 rubygems

Version Path
fastlane-2.65.0.beta.20171111010004 screengrab/lib/screengrab/setup.rb
fastlane-2.65.0.beta.20171110010003 screengrab/lib/screengrab/setup.rb
fastlane-2.65.0.beta.20171109010003 screengrab/lib/screengrab/setup.rb
fastlane-2.65.0.beta.20171108010003 screengrab/lib/screengrab/setup.rb
fastlane-2.65.0.beta.20171107010003 screengrab/lib/screengrab/setup.rb
fastlane-2.64.0 screengrab/lib/screengrab/setup.rb
fastlane-2.64.0.beta.20171106010003 screengrab/lib/screengrab/setup.rb
fastlane-2.64.0.beta.20171105010003 screengrab/lib/screengrab/setup.rb
fastlane-2.64.0.beta.20171104010004 screengrab/lib/screengrab/setup.rb
fastlane-2.64.0.beta.20171103010004 screengrab/lib/screengrab/setup.rb
fastlane-2.64.0.beta.20171102010003 screengrab/lib/screengrab/setup.rb
fastlane-2.64.0.beta.20171101010004 screengrab/lib/screengrab/setup.rb
fastlane-2.63.0 screengrab/lib/screengrab/setup.rb
fastlane-2.63.0.beta.20171031010003 screengrab/lib/screengrab/setup.rb
fastlane-2.63.0.beta.20171030010003 screengrab/lib/screengrab/setup.rb
fastlane-2.63.0.beta.20171029010003 screengrab/lib/screengrab/setup.rb
fastlane-2.63.0.beta.20171028010003 screengrab/lib/screengrab/setup.rb
fastlane-2.63.0.beta.20171027010003 screengrab/lib/screengrab/setup.rb
fastlane-2.63.0.beta.20171026010003 screengrab/lib/screengrab/setup.rb
fastlane-2.63.0.beta.20171025010003 screengrab/lib/screengrab/setup.rb